Walmart reported Q2 FY2027 revenue of $187.9B and adjusted EPS of $0.81, both beating estimates, but US same-store sales growth of 2.6% was the lowest in over six years due to pharmacy price deflation. The company raised its full-year guidance, though the upper end of EPS guidance still missed consensus, signaling slowing growth momentum.

Gold and Bitcoin have both broken out, with Bitcoin surpassing its bear market trendline and the 21-week moving average, while gold rebounds after a correction. The US government debt surpassing $40 trillion and 10-year Treasury yields near 4.70% are pressuring long-term financing costs, prompting the Treasury to expand buybacks. This macro backdrop is driving renewed interest in hard assets like gold and bitcoin as hedges against debt expansion.

CFTC Chair Michael Selig outlined a ‘New Frontier of Finance’ roadmap covering crypto, AI compute markets, and prediction markets. He emphasized that if Congress fails to pass crypto market structure legislation, the CFTC is prepared to use its existing authority to regulate crypto asset markets. The agency is also exploring rules for compute markets and reforming event contract regulations.
